Pasta Santa Caterina

Ingredients:

2 lb. ripe tomatoes (I used 2 cans diced tomatoes drained)
2 Tbsp. Italian parsley, chopped
2 Tbsp. fresh Basil, chopped (I used 1 Tbsp. dried Basil)
2 tsp. garlic minced
3 Tbsp. freshly grated Parmesan cheese
1 tsp. dried oregano
6 Tbsp. olive oil
1/2 tsp. salt
1/2 tsp. black pepper
1 lb. spaghetti

Directions:

Peel tomatoes, remove seeds and dice.

In a medium bowl combine all of the ingredients except the pasta.
Marinate at room temperature for about 1 hour.

Cook the pasta according to package directions, until tender. Drain thoroughly, and transfer pasta to a heated serving dish. Add the sauce and toss. Adjust seasonings and serve with extra Parmesan cheese.

Serves 8 to 10.



Grant, we beseech Thee, almighty God, that commemorating the Heavenly birthday of blessed Catherine, Thy virgin, we may both rejoice on her yearly festival and benefit by the example of so great a virtue. Through our Lord Jesus Christ, Thy Son, Who liveth and reigneth with Thee in the unity of the Holy Ghost, world without end. Amen.
